The soundtrack for the movie "Gravity" was composed by Steven Price and is known for its immersive and intense score, which played a crucial role in enhancing the overall cinematic experience of the film. Here are some interesting facts about the "Gravity" OST:
Experimental Sound Design: Steven Price employed a unique approach to create the soundtrack for "Gravity." He used a combination of electronic and experimental sound design techniques to capture the feeling of isolation and tension in space. This included using unusual instruments and recording methods to achieve the desired soundscapes.
Sonically Immersive: The soundtrack was designed to be an integral part of the film's storytelling. Price worked closely with director Alfonso Cuarón to synchronize the music with the on-screen action, creating a sonically immersive experience that heightened the tension and emotions of the characters.
Minimalist Approach: Price adopted a minimalist approach for some of the tracks, using repetitive motifs and subtle changes in dynamics to convey the vastness and emptiness of space. This minimalist style contributed to the film's sense of isolation and loneliness.
Oscar-Winning Score: Steven Price's work on the "Gravity" OST earned him critical acclaim and recognition. In 2014, he won the Academy Award for Best Original Score, cementing the soundtrack's place in film music history.
Use of Silence: Price used silence strategically in the soundtrack to create moments of tension and anticipation. The absence of music at key points in the film allowed for a heightened sense of realism and emphasized the characters' vulnerability in space.
